PC Easter, Sick Again When the Bunny Comes to Visit

by: Levi Blackman

When the Spring Bunny Attacks Your Soul

My sister had an Easter party one year when we used to live in a nice big house made to host large groups of people. We all rocked out to The Cure or something equivalent in her room, dancing in a big circle. Earlier that day I found myself face first in a basket of candy, and all the dancing mixed with chocolate didn’t set well with my stomach. I threw up in front of all her friends.

I tell that story a lot.


Spring Bunny Can Eat Poop

This year had a film of dejavu when I hear listening over the radio that somebody someplace wanted to change the “Easter Bunny” to the “Spring Bunny” so as to not upset anyone. My stomach started to bubble, and I felt sick.

Could they really think this will make the world any better of a place? Is the word “Easter” something that should be reserved for private Christian conversations only? Does anyone really get offended when they hear the word Easter?

I don’t get offended when I see or hear Easter. I don’t take the word as a personal attack against my religion and beliefs or lack of. It sounds like someone with no confidence thought the stupid thought that Easter signifies religion and offends all those who don’t celebrate thought they would make everyone feel a whole lot better. Somehow it made it through the maze of the media and it is big news.

“Let us change the Bunny for the betterment of mankind!”

Oh come on, the Bunny delivers eggs. What bunny delivers eggs other than the Easter Bunny?

The Cadbury Bunny? Great, brand recognition. My high school economic teacher was right.

All the chocolate, and the PC; my stomach can’t take such harsh treatment. Maybe if people looked a little more into what Easter should symbolize rather than the symbols of chocolate and shiny basket straw. I am going to go take a shit.
